Slovakia 1944 Definitive Issue Set
Slovakia · 1944 · Various
This set of five definitive stamps was issued by the First Slovak Republic during World War II. The designs feature prominent figures from Slovak history, including Prince Pribina, King Svätopluk I, Anton Bernolák, Ľudovít Štúr, and Andrej Hlinka, rendered in detailed portraits.
Issued by the First Slovak Republic, a client state of Nazi Germany, these stamps reflect a nationalistic focus on key figures from the country's history and cultural development.
